καθώς kathōs
Greek word for “as/just as” · Strong’s G2531 · used 182 times in 179 verses
Meaning
καθώς, (i.e. καθ᾽ ὡς), Hellenistic for καθά, which see, καθάπερ, καθό, καθότι (Mayser, 485;
